I think what is always underestimated when it comes to setting passwords, though, is the importance of having different passwords for different services.  Most people have passwords in hundreds of different things, and if your password for a less secure service is the same as your password for a more secure service, it doesn't only matter what that password is - the hacker is going to hack the less secure service, find your password and use it to get into your account on the more secure service.

The way I see it, with all these Vault 7 exploits and backdoors in Cloudflare... no PASSWORD will be safe. You can have the strongest password,

and people will still spoof the site or use key loggers or swap sims to hijack the 2FA. The site should be the strongest point, but it turns out these

sites are the weakest link. Bitcoin used without 3rd parties are still the recommended way to use Bitcoin.  Wink
